Structural engineer services involve assessing, designing, and analyzing the structural components of a building or property to ensure safety, stability, and compliance with building codes. These professionals evaluate existing structures for potential issues, such as foundation settlement, load-bearing capacity, or structural deterioration. They also develop plans and specifications for new constructions or modifications, ensuring that the structures can withstand various forces and meet safety standards. Their expertise helps prevent structural failures and supports the integrity of buildings throughout their lifespan.

One of the primary problems addressed by structural engineer services is structural instability, which can arise from design flaws, material degradation, or unforeseen load conditions. These services are essential when properties experience issues like cracks, sagging floors, or foundation movement. Structural engineers identify the root causes of such problems through detailed inspections and analyses, recommending appropriate solutions to reinforce or repair the affected elements. This proactive approach can help property owners avoid costly repairs and reduce safety risks associated with compromised structures.

Various types of properties utilize structural engineering services, including residential homes, commercial buildings, and industrial facilities. In residential settings, these services are often sought during renovations, additions, or foundation repairs. Commercial properties, such as office buildings or retail centers, frequently require structural assessments to support remodeling projects or to ensure compliance with safety regulations. Industrial facilities, which often involve complex or heavy-duty structures, also benefit from professional structural evaluations to maintain operational safety and stability.

The overview below groups typical Structural Engineer Service proj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Cumming, GA.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Design Consultation - The cost for structural engineering design consultation typically ranges from $500 to $2,500, depending on project complexity. For example, a small residential addition might cost around $700, while a large commercial project could be closer to $2,000.

Structural Analysis - Structural analysis services generally fall between $1,000 and $4,000. Simple assessments for existing structures may be around $1,200, whereas detailed analysis for new construction can reach $3,500 or more.

Foundation Evaluation - Foundation evaluation costs usually range from $800 to $2,500. A basic inspection of a single-family home might be approximately $1,000, while comprehensive assessments for commercial buildings could be higher.

Construction Documentation - Preparing detailed construction documents can cost between $2,000 and $6,000. Smaller projects might be around $2,500, with larger or more complex projects potentially exceeding $5,000.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

When selecting a structural engineer for a project, it’s important to consider their level of experience and expertise. Homeowners should look for professionals who have a proven track record with similar projects and a comprehensive understanding of local building codes and regulations. Clear, written expectations regarding scope of work, deliverables, and timelines help ensure that both parties are aligned, reducing the potential for misunderstandings or surprises during the project.

Reputable references and a history of satisfied clients can provide valuable insight into a structural engineer’s reliability and quality of work. Homeowners are encouraged to ask for references or examples of completed projects in their area, such as nearby neighborhoods or commercial districts, to gauge the professional’s experience with local conditions. Additionally, a good communication style-marked by responsiveness, clarity, and transparency-can make the process more straightforward and less stressful for homeowners.
